Par-Li & Co Boutique is a unique name and its origin speaks to the family nature of the business. “We are a mother daughter duo,” says owners Brittany Gipe and Mary Wilson. “Our business was originally named Par-Li after Brittany’s two sons, Parker and Liam. Then Cohen came along and now we are Par-Li & Co!” The two first started their fashion line online only, but success led them to recently open a retail shop as well.
Of course, the pandemic has been particularly hard on brick and mortar shops and Par-Li & Co has been no different. “We had to close in March, which was difficult,” says Brittany. “But it forced us to go back to our roots and transitioned fully back to online. The community and our customers have embraced our transition which has helped tremendously,” adds Mary.
Showing their appreciation for the community is now a big part of their efforts and that’s why the jumped at the opportunity to join Columbia Bank’s Pass It On Project. Par-Li & Co is providing free gifts and clothing to staff and residents at Molalla Manor, a local senior living facility, and Columbia Bank is paying the bill. “We had a family member who was a resident at this facility, and they do an amazing job,” says Brittany. “With Columbia Bank’s support, we hope we can help brighten their day.”
